
JA-150N Wireless power output module PG
The JA-150N is a wireless component of the JABLOTRON 100
system. It provides an output power relay switch. It can be used
for switching on/off the lights, ventilators, etc. The relay can
be controlled with a programable control panel (PG) output
or according to the status of a section (set = relay on) or when
there is an alarm in a chosen section (alarm = relay on). The device
should be installed by a trained technician with a valid certificate
issued by an authorised distributor.
Installation
The module can be installed into a JA-190PL mounting box.
For proper module functioning, it is necessary to have a JA-110R
radio module installed in the system.
x The setting of individual programmable outputs is done in the PG
outputs tab in the F-Link software. A detailed description of the
settings is available in the control panel installation manual.
x When the output is set according to the SECTION SET table the
relay is on if the section is fully set.
x When the output is set according to the SECTION ALARM table
the relay is on if there is an external or internal warning (EW
or IW).

1 Use the switch(1) to set the required PG output or section
to which the relay should react (see tables).
2 Connect the main power cable to the mains terminals (4); turn
the main power on.
Electrical devices can only be
connected by an authorized
technician.
The product is used for single pole
switching of a single line and it does
not provide safe disconnection of
both mains lines.
3 After starting up, the yellow LED (5) starts to light
permanently. Briefly press the button (6) and the LED starts to
blink and enrollment mode is opened. In the F-Link software
go to F-Link – Settings – Devices and press the button
called Send enrollment signal. The module will confirm
enrolling by a 2 sec flash. If the module does not receive an
enrollment code in 120 sec., enrollment mode is closed (LED
lit) and it waits for enrollment mode to be opened again.
4 Test the module‘s functioning. Relay switching is indicated
by the red LED (7).
5 Connect the device to be controlled to the relay terminals (3).
Notes:
x The module does not occupy any position in control panel.
x Only one control panel can be enrolled to the module.
x If you connect multiple modules with identical settings to the
system, the relays will have the same function.
x The relay switches to standby mode when it loses AC or
communication is lost for 2 hours. After AC restoration
or communication restoration the module will switch to the
requested mode in 8 sec.
x You can erase an enrolled control panel by pressing and holding
the button (6) for 6 sec. Erasing is confirmed by 6x quick flashes
of the LED (5). Then the LED starts flashing and the module
opens enrollment mode.

Technical specifications
Power supply; power consumption 230 V/50 Hz; 1.5W
Communication band 868.1 MHz
Relay contact loadability (3) – safety class II:
Maximum acceptable relay voltage 250 V AC
Resistive load (cosij=1) max.16A
Inductive (capacitive) load (cosij=0.4) max. 8A
Halogen lighting max. 1000 W
Minimum acceptable relay throughput DC 0.5 W
Wire diameter: max. 2 x 1.5mm
Dimensions 82 x 50 x 19mm
Operational environment to EN 50131-1 Indoor general
Operating temperature range -10 to + 40°C
Also complies with ETSI EN 300220, EN 50130-4,
EN 55022, EN 60950-1
